I installed my home battery last spring, mainly to stop buying expensive electricity in the evening. My solar panels already covered most daytime use, but the house still pulled power from the grid between 4 p.m. and 9 p.m., when rates were highest. That was the part of my bill that annoyed me most.

I was not chasing the biggest possible setup; I wanted a safe, reasonably compact solar battery that would last for years and work with my existing hybrid inverter.
On a normal sunny day, the panels run the refrigerator, router, lights, and washing machine first. Once the battery reaches roughly 95 percent, extra solar charges it. Around 4 p.m., the battery automatically switches over and supplies the house. I usually finish the evening with 30 to 40 percent remaining, then the system charges again the next morning.
The practical difference is clear on my utility bill. Before adding storage, my summer bill averaged about $145. Afterward, it fell to around $65, although weather and air-conditioning use still make the number move around. The battery does not eliminate every grid charge, but avoiding those peak-hour rates has made the investment feel worthwhile.
I did have one small troubleshooting moment. After a firmware update, the app showed the battery as unavailable even though the inverter display looked normal. I restarted the communications gateway, waited a few minutes, and reconnected it to Wi-Fi. Everything came back, and the battery had continued operating the whole time. That experience taught me to check the hardware before assuming the storage system had failed.
What I like most is the quiet routine: solar charges the battery, the battery carries the evening, and the grid becomes the backup instead of my first source of power.
